X-Git-Url: https://git.openstreetmap.org./rails.git/blobdiff_plain/3e99bbf5a9e124a59fc5ae72c863e89af7fa8c46..0b97b6bc343d8428367e5fa91ef41e95386880f7:/db/migrate/045_create_user_blocks.rb?ds=sidebyside diff --git a/db/migrate/045_create_user_blocks.rb b/db/migrate/045_create_user_blocks.rb index b3313ce92..4328e0b97 100644 --- a/db/migrate/045_create_user_blocks.rb +++ b/db/migrate/045_create_user_blocks.rb @@ -1,7 +1,5 @@ -require 'migrate' - -class CreateUserBlocks < ActiveRecord::Migration - def self.up +class CreateUserBlocks < ActiveRecord::Migration[4.2] + def change create_table :user_blocks do |t| t.column :user_id, :bigint, :null => false t.column :moderator_id, :bigint, :null => false @@ -10,17 +8,13 @@ class CreateUserBlocks < ActiveRecord::Migration t.column :needs_view, :boolean, :null => false, :default => false t.column :revoker_id, :bigint - t.timestamps + t.timestamps :null => true end - add_foreign_key :user_blocks, [:user_id], :users, [:id] - add_foreign_key :user_blocks, [:moderator_id], :users, [:id] - add_foreign_key :user_blocks, [:revoker_id], :users, [:id] + add_foreign_key :user_blocks, :users, :name => "user_blocks_user_id_fkey" + add_foreign_key :user_blocks, :users, :column => :moderator_id, :name => "user_blocks_moderator_id_fkey" + add_foreign_key :user_blocks, :users, :column => :revoker_id, :name => "user_blocks_revoker_id_fkey" add_index :user_blocks, [:user_id] end - - def self.down - drop_table :user_blocks - end end